OpenCode AI编程工具功能特点及官方网址入口

62 ℃
Trae:新一代免费的AI编程工具

OpenCode是一款专为开发者打造的开源AI编程助手,核心聚焦提升开发效率与代码质量,支持以终端界面、桌面应用、IDE插件三种形式灵活部署。通过深度集成OpenAI、Claude等多种语言模型(LLM),它能精准理解代码结构与逻辑模式,为开发者提供全流程智能支持——从代码生成、逻辑优化到团队协作辅助,全方位适配现代开发需求。凭借高度的灵活性与可定制性,OpenCode可无缝融入各类开发环境与工作流程,成为开发者的智能协作伙伴。

OpenCode AI编程工具

OpenCode核心功能:

1、代码深度解释与理解

快速解析复杂代码库,清晰阐释代码逻辑、功能用途及设计思路,帮助开发者快速上手陌生项目,降低代码阅读门槛。

2、全链路新功能开发支持

只需输入功能需求,即可从开发计划到代码实现全流程辅助,自动生成符合项目规范的新功能代码,大幅缩短开发周期。

3、代码修改与优化重构

直接对现有代码进行修改、逻辑优化或架构重构,精准提升代码可读性、性能与安全性,助力打造高质量代码库。

4、灵活撤销/重做更改

支持`/undo`(撤销)、`/redo`(重做)命令,轻松回溯代码修改历史,避免误操作带来的开发风险,调试更安心。

5、智能规划前置保障

修改代码前自动生成详细开发计划,明确实现步骤、潜在风险与优化方向,确保开发方向不偏离,减少返工成本。

6、多环境全场景适配

兼容终端、桌面应用、IDE扩展三种使用形态,适配不同开发场景——无论是快速终端调试、桌面端集中开发,还是IDE内实时辅助,都能无缝衔接。

7、多语言模型自由选择

深度集成OpenAI、Claude等主流语言模型,开发者可根据项目需求、性能偏好灵活切换模型,兼顾不同场景下的使用体验。

OpenCode快速上手:

1、按需安装部署

根据操作系统选择适配的安装方式:支持通过安装脚本、Node.js、Homebrew、Chocolatey或Scoop等工具一键安装,也可直接部署为IDE插件。

2、简单配置语言模型

获取OpenCode Zen等语言模型提供商的API密钥,在终端中输入`/connect`命令完成配置,快速打通AI能力接口。

3、项目初始化分析

进入目标项目目录,启动OpenCode后执行`/init`命令,工具将自动分析项目结构,生成AGENTS.md文件,精准掌握项目核心信息。

4、灵活交互完成开发任务

通过自然语言提问、需求描述触发功能——比如“添加用户登录功能”“优化这段代码性能”,也可使用`/undo`/`/redo`命令调整修改,或分享对话同步协作思路。

5、个性化定制适配

可按需调整主题样式、快捷键设置,或配置代码格式化器,让工具完全匹配个人开发习惯,提升使用舒适度。

OpenCode应用场景:

1、代码学习与项目上手

帮助编程初学者快速理解复杂代码逻辑,加速掌握编程知识点与项目架构,大幅缩短学习曲线。

2、新功能快速实现

针对个人项目或团队开发中的新功能需求,提供从计划到落地的全流程辅助,提升功能迭代效率。

3、团队代码审查前置

开发前生成详细实现计划,便于团队提前评估方案可行性、讨论优化方向,统一开发认知,减少后期审查返工。

4、代码问题排查与修复

快速定位代码中的Bug与潜在问题,解释错误根源并提供精准修复建议,提升调试效率。

5、编程教学辅助

作为教学工具,生成直观的示例代码、解释编程概念,帮助学生更好地理解技术原理,提升教学效果。

进入OpenCode官网入口

TalkCody:开源跨平台AI编程助手,原生性能+多模态高效协作

文心快码:百度开发的一款基于文心大模型的智能代码助手

MarsCode算法刷题官网入口,豆包旗下的智能编程助手

PingCode官网:一款专为研发团队设计的项目管理工具

JetBrains Junie:JetBrains推出的一款AI编程助手

标签: AI编程助手, IDE插件

上面是“OpenCode AI编程工具功能特点及官方网址入口”的全面内容,想了解更多关于 IT知识 内容,请继续关注web建站教程。

当前网址:https://m.ipkd.cn/webs_26244.html

声明:本站提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请发送到邮箱:admin@ipkd.cn,我们会在看到邮件的第一时间内为您处理!

生活小工具

收录了万年历、老黄历、八字智能排盘等100+款小工具!生活小工具

猜你喜欢